I just installed PostgreSQL 7.0.2 on a RedHat 6.1 machine using rpm. now I am trying to run initdb: $ initdb -r /usr/local/pgsql/data /usr/bin/initdb: [: integer expression expected before -eq /usr/bin/initdb: [: integer expression expected before -ne We are initializing the database system with username postgres (uid=uid=40(postg res)). This user will own all the files and must also own the server process. Creating template database in /usr/local/pgsql/data/base/template1 ERROR: pg_atoi: error in "uid": can't parse "uid" ERROR: pg_atoi: error in "uid": can't parse "uid" syntax error 20 : parse errorinitdb: could not create template database initdb: cleaning up by wiping out /usr/local/pgsql/data/base/template1 not sure why this is happening, but I can't seem to overcome it. There is no initdb -D, but initdb -r seems to do accomplish the same thing.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ks, Nickou
